What is a First Five job?

'First Five' typically refers to the First 5 programs or organizations that focus on early childhood development, particularly from birth to age five. These jobs often involve supporting young children and their families through health, education, and developmental services. Roles may include program coordinators, family support specialists, early childhood educators, and outreach workers. Employees in these positions work to ensure children are healthy, safe, and prepared for school, often collaborating with community organizations and public agencies. The work is vital for setting the foundation for lifelong learning and well-being.

If you find yourself at a professional crossroads, a career as a financial advisor may be the right change for you. Financial advisors partner with clients to help them achieve their long-term financial goals: retirement, building wealth, estate strategies, funding education and more. As a financial advisor with Edward Jones, you'll develop and grow your own practice, supported by your branch team, a home-office team and other regional financial advisors. You'll benefit from the experience that comes from 100 years of history. We're proud to have more offices in the U.S. and Canada than any other investment firm, serving over eight million clients.
Our financial advisors are valued partners, and we credit much of our success to their unique experiences and professional backgrounds. We value an inclusive environment where everyone's different viewpoints help to achieve results. Financial advisors lead the branch team to serve clients and contribute to the firm's purpose. They deeply understand the client's goals and why they are important to accelerate trust and help them stay on track. Edward Jones helps you positively impact clients' lives and work together to achieve their long-term financial goals, enabling you to make a difference in your community.
